Meaning and History: The Origin of the Midjourney Identity
Midjourney was founded in August 2021 by David Holz, previously known for co-founding Leap Motion. Initially operating with a small engineering team, the project was conceived as an experimental research lab rather than a traditional startup. Its goal was not simply to automate image creation, but to explore how artificial intelligence could act as a collaborator in human creativity.
The name “Midjourney” itself defines the brand’s conceptual core. It suggests a state of becoming rather than arrival, emphasizing process over outcome. This philosophy directly influenced the logo meaning and the broader brand identity. Rather than focusing on futuristic motifs or data-driven symbolism, Midjourney chose imagery that evokes exploration and open-ended creation.
The platform gained widespread attention in 2022 through its Discord-based interface, rapidly attracting artists, designers, and architects. By the end of 2024, Midjourney had grown to tens of millions of users worldwide, reinforcing the relevance of its understated but memorable visual identity.
Midjourney Logo History Timeline
2021–Today: The Sailboat of Creative Exploration.
Since its public emergence, Midjourney has consistently used a single primary logo: a hand-drawn-style sailboat floating on stylized waves. Rendered in monochrome black on white, the emblem has remained unchanged, reinforcing brand continuity and recognizability.
The sailboat is deliberately minimal. Its thick, confident lines resemble a quick sketch rather than a polished corporate mark, aligning with the idea that Midjourney transforms simple prompts into complex imagery. The forward-leaning sails introduce a sense of motion, subtly conveying progress, curiosity, and momentum.
By resisting redesigns or visual embellishment, Midjourney communicates confidence in its original concept. The logo functions as a stable anchor in a rapidly evolving AI landscape, reminding users that the journey of creation is ongoing rather than version-dependent.

Logo Symbolism: Imagination, Motion, and Creative Freedom
The Midjourney logo symbolism is deeply narrative. The sailboat represents a voyage into the unknown, mirroring the creative process itself. Just as a sailor sets direction without fully knowing the destination, users provide prompts that initiate exploration rather than dictate outcomes.
The waves beneath the boat suggest fluidity and uncertainty, core characteristics of generative art. There is no rigid path, only movement shaped by interaction between human intention and machine interpretation. This reinforces Midjourney’s positioning as a collaborative tool rather than a deterministic system.
The absence of color is equally significant. Black and white remove emotional bias, allowing users to project their own imagination onto the platform. This restraint strengthens the logo symbolism by leaving conceptual space rather than filling it with predefined meaning.
Typography and Visual Restraint
Midjourney’s logo description is incomplete without acknowledging what it omits. There is no wordmark embedded in the primary emblem, no technical references, and no overt AI symbolism. This absence is intentional. By avoiding typographic dominance, the brand allows the symbol to operate universally across languages and cultures.
When text is used, it appears in clean, neutral sans-serif forms, reinforcing clarity without distraction. This minimalism ensures that the logo never competes with the artwork generated by the platform itself.
